Father of the National Parks and founder of the Sierra Club, John Muir became a leader in protecting America's wilderness. Students explore Muir's life as he takes his 1,000-mile walk from Indiana to Florida to study geology and botany. Students will see some of Muir's journal sketches and read about how he traveled to Alaska to study glaciers. His legacy lives on in the celebration of Earth Day, April 21, which is also Muir's birthday.
